  • Publication number: 20220213571
    Abstract: In the austenitic stainless steel material of the present disclosure, the chemical composition consists of, by mass %, C: 0.100% or less, Si: 1.00% or less, Mn: 5.00% or less, Cr: 15.00 to 22.00%, Ni: 10.00 to 21.00%, Mo: 1.20 to 4.50%, P: 0.050% or less, S: 0.050% or less, Al: 0.100% or less, N: 0.100% or less, and Cu: 0 to 0.70%, with the balance being Fe and impurities, and an austenite grain size No. determined in accordance with ASTM E112 is from 5.0 to less than 8.0, and in a cross section perpendicular to the longitudinal direction of the austenitic stainless steel material, the dislocation cell structure ratio is from 50 to less than 80%, and the number density of precipitates with a long axis of 1.0 ?m or more is 5.0 per 0.2 mm2 or less.
